Lazio, Baroni after the 1-1 draw in England: “I’m happy. Dele Bashiru had surgery on a tooth”

Marco Baroni, Lazio coachspoke to the club’s official channels after the 1-1 friendly draw at Southampton: “Tonight was a real match, played with the right attitude and compactness. These are difficult matches, in my opinion there was a foul on Isaksen under our bench for their goal but we played with personality, the mentality we are looking for. I’m happy. We need to bring out the collective, play together, be in the match. Dele Bashiru didn’t come on because he had a tooth operation, but we had a few defections. I wanted to bring in Castovilli, Gila. They need to get into shape straight away. The group is growing. We managed with personality, we attacked, we managed the duels well”.

What information do you take home with you?
“In the next game we will increase the minutes of players who have played less, we are waiting for the imminent entrance of Tavares. We must not think about the starting 11 but about the team. They must all be ready to come in, this is the mentality I want to give to this team. I don’t like positional football, the evolution of football sees dynamism, pressure, this takes away the plays from the opponent. We work for this, the boys are following, they realize that it is better to run forward than backward. Balance is needed but the team did well. They were physical, they have rhythm, we were always in the game even when there was the expulsion”.

What a feat Castellanos.
“Taty scored, but I underlined that ball that didn’t go in. A player like him has to score. We had chances, like with Lazzari but also many others. We have to attack the area, the goal, we have to shoot”
